Clarendon Press, Oxford, 1970 reprint of 1900 first edition. Cloth, gilt cover device, 4to, 33 cm,. ix, 16, xvi, 203 pp, ills, facs. From the blurb: "Horace Hart's Century is a display and a record of the typefaces given to the University of Oxford in the seventeenth century by Bishop John Fell and of other types and ornaments cast in old matrices preserved at the Press. In an appendix Hart prints the letters exchanged between Fell and his agent in Holland about the purchase of matrices and type. The author, Printer to the University from 1883 until 1915 printed 150 copies of his book in 1900 and gave them to people prominent in the literary world. It has not been reprinted previously. The Century has come to be regarded as a classic authority by students of typographical history. This reprint by photo-lithography is supplemented by an introduction and notes. Research done since the book was issued, particularly by the late Stanley Morison into the origins of the Fell types, is digested in the notes at the end of the book, and some revisions by Hart have been added. This edition is, therefore, an up-to-date survey of one of the world's richest collections of historic printing types. The added matter is hand-set in Fell types and printed directly from them. It includes a list of recipients of the original edition." In the original edition Hart had attempted to reproduce and represent by types in existence, by types cast for the purpose, or by "Process" blocks where no types existed, all the Types, Devices, Ornaments, etc. as shown in the "Specimens" dated or undated 1693-1794.
